Ensuring Informed Consent and Participant Safety in Research
This chapter explores the vital steps taken to achieve informed consent and protect participants in research among rural communities, particularly focusing on farmers with limited digital access. It highlights the importance of understanding household dynamics and the necessity for ongoing engagement to foster awareness and clarity regarding research implications.
